Long term exposure to high nitrates will do them in. Causes kidney and liver failure. The stress from trying to cope with it leaves them open to opportunistic infections.

I said a minimum for GF is 5x the turn over. That would be on lower stock count.

I keep mostly show quality imports I stock mine at 20 gallons per adult and I tack on another 10 gallons for every inch over 7inches. Filtration turns over 10x the volume of the enclosure and I also run sponge filters. Automatic water change system changes 100% of the water 2x a week

I'm sure all that sounds excessive but my nitrates stay at 5-0ppm. And I've not had a kidney failure death from my breeding animals in 15yrs.

Its not unreasonable to me to drop $500+ dollars on a well bred animal so water quality is vital to maintain. I also do take in rescue fish myself so I've gotten a bit of pratice at diagnosis and treatment.
